Camden Property Trust’s gain of +1.11% occurred on what appeared to be normal trading activity, without any dramatic volume spike. The price move pushed the stock back toward the middle of its recent range established since the last earnings report. As a real estate investment trust (REIT) focused on multifamily properties, CPT often moves in sympathy with interest rate expectations and broader housing market trends. The recent uptick may reflect modest sector rotation into defensive, income-oriented names amid mixed economic data. The stock’s ability to hold above the $108 area—a prior resistance-turned-support level—suggests buyers are stepping in at current valuations. However, without a clear catalyst such as a company-specific announcement or sector-wide news, the move appears driven by normal price discovery within a consolidating pattern. The exact level of $108.94 places the stock roughly midway between its established support at $103.49 and resistance at $114.39, leaving room for either continuation or reversal depending on incoming market sentiment and any macro developments regarding Federal Reserve policy or apartment rental trends.

Faster access to data can provide a temporary advantage. From a technical perspective, CPT’s price action shows a series of higher lows since the stock found support near the mid-$103 area. The stock has been trading in a channel between $103.49 and $114.39, and the current price of $108.94 sits near the midpoint of that range. Momentum indicators such as the Relative Strength Index (RSI) likely reside in the neutral zone, perhaps in the mid-50s, indicating neither overbought nor oversold conditions. The moving average convergence divergence (MACD) may be close to its signal line, suggesting potential for a cross that could confirm short-term direction. Volume has been relatively steady, failing to provide a clear breakout signal. The resistance level at $114.39 is critical—it represents a price ceiling tested in past months. If the stock can build momentum and close decisively above $114.39, it could signal a shift to a higher trading band. Conversely, a failure to hold above $108 could lead to a re-test of support near $103.49. The stock’s 50-day moving average likely lies around the $107–$108 range, further reinforcing that area as a near-term pivot.

Interest rates, employment data, and GDP growth often influence investor sentiment and sector-specific trends. Looking ahead, CPT’s trajectory will depend on several factors. A sustained move above resistance at $114.39 could open the door to a challenge of higher levels, potentially targeting the $118–$120 zone where prior congestion exists. However, failure to clear that level might result in a pullback toward the support zone near $103.49. The stock’s performance is sensitive to interest rate expectations—if bond yields decline, REITs like Camden Property Trust may attract more buyers. Conversely, rising yields could cap upside. Additionally, apartment rental demand trends and occupancy rates will influence investor sentiment. Any company-specific news, such as quarterly earnings or portfolio updates, could serve as a catalyst. Traders may watch the $110–$112 area as a potential intermediate resistance before the main $114.39 level. In the absence of a clear catalyst, the stock is likely to remain range-bound, offering opportunities for tactical moves within the established boundaries. The current price action suggests a neutral-to-slightly-bullish bias, but confirmation from volume or a catalyst is needed before a more decisive trend emerges.
